ZIP Code 98396: frequently asked questions
- What is the median home value in ZIP Code 98396?
- The median home value in ZIP Code 98396 is $485,400, higher than 87% of U.S. ZIP codes.
- How much is property tax in ZIP Code 98396?
- The median annual property tax in ZIP Code 98396 is $3,870, an effective rate of 1% of home value.
- Is ZIP Code 98396 expensive to live in?
- Homes in ZIP Code 98396 cost about 4.33× the median household income, higher than 79% of U.S. ZIP codes.
- What is the average rent in ZIP Code 98396?
- The median gross rent in ZIP Code 98396 is $1,173 a month, higher than 71% of U.S. ZIP codes.
- What is the weather like in ZIP Code 98396?
- ZIP Code 98396 averages 49.9°F year-round, summer highs near 72.4°F, winter lows around 33°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als). It sees about 4.3 inches of snow a year.
